What to Expect in a Multi-Drop Bus

In earlier DDR systems, the clock, command, and address signals (here in referred to as C/A) were distributed to multiple DRAMs using a forked topology, in which these signals propagate to all the DRAMs in the system at approximately the same time. The propagation delays on the command and address lines (in such systems) introduced timing skew into the system, limiting the operating frequency of the bus and eventually impacting the performance of these memory systems.

Utilizing Fine Line PCBs with High Density BGAs

With the recent introduction of the Averatek Semi-Additive Process (A-SAP) process, linewidths under 1 mil are possible using the same fabrication processing line as for traditional 4 mil wide lines. This opens up the possibility of using narrower traces in the BGA escape region than in long-path routing regions. However, using this routing architecture means the narrower traces in the BGA escape field are at a higher impedance than the wider, 50 ohm traces in the routing region. So, how long can these traces be before the impedance mismatch is a problem? The authors of this piece propose an analysis methodology to find out.
